How To Fix OO225 - Meta relationship &1 &2: Metarelationship does not exist


SAP Error Message - Details

  • Message type: E = Error

  • Message class: OO - Class Builder/API

  • Message number: 225

  • Message text: Meta relationship &1 &2: Metarelationship does not exist

  • What is the cause and solution for SAP error message OO225 - Meta relationship &1 &2: Metarelationship does not exist ?

    The SAP error message OO225 indicates that there is a problem with a meta-relationship in the system. Specifically, it states that the meta-relationship you are trying to use does not exist. This error typically occurs in the context of Object-Oriented (OO) programming or when dealing with Business Object (BO) relationships in SAP.

    Cause:

    1. Non-Existent Meta-Relationship: The specified meta-relationship (indicated by &1 and &2 in the error message) has not been defined in the system.
    2. Incorrect Configuration: There may be a configuration issue where the meta-relationship is expected but not properly set up.
    3. Data Inconsistency: The data being processed may reference a meta-relationship that has been deleted or is not active.
    4. Typographical Error: There could be a typo in the name or identifier of the meta-relationship being referenced.

    Solution:

    1. Check Meta-Relationship Definition:

      • Go to the relevant transaction (e.g., transaction code SWO1 for Business Object Builder) and verify if the meta-relationship exists.
      • If it does not exist, you may need to create it or correct the reference in your code or configuration.
    2. Review Configuration:

      • Ensure that all necessary configurations related to the meta-relationship are correctly set up in the system.
      • Check if the meta-relationship is active and properly linked to the relevant objects.
    3. Correct Data References:

      • If the error arises from specific data entries, review the data to ensure that it references valid and existing meta-relationships.
    4. Consult Documentation:

      • Refer to SAP documentation or help resources for guidance on how to define and manage meta-relationships.
    5. Debugging:

      • If you have access to debugging tools, you can trace the execution to see where the error is being triggered and gather more context about the issue.
    6. Contact SAP Support:

      • If you are unable to resolve the issue, consider reaching out to SAP support for assistance, especially if this is a production environment.
